The Hajj is one of the most important religious pilgrimages in the world. Every year, millions of Muslims from all over the world travel to Mecca, Saudi Arabia, to perform the Hajj. The Hajj is a journey of a lifetime, and it is an experience that will stay with you forever.

The Hajj is a pilgrimage to the holy city of Mecca. It is one of the five pillars of Islam, and it is obligatory for all able-bodied Muslims to perform the Hajj at least once in their lifetime. The Hajj is a spiritual journey, and it is a time for Muslims to reflect on their faith and to renew their commitment to God.

The History of the Hajj

The Hajj is a tradition that dates back to the time of the Prophet Muhammad. In 632 AD, the Prophet Muhammad led a group of Muslims on the first Hajj pilgrimage. The Hajj has been performed every year since then, and it is now one of the most important religious pilgrimages in the world.

The Rites of the Hajj

The Hajj is a complex pilgrimage, and it involves a number of different rites and rituals. The main rites of the Hajj are:

  • Tawaf: Circling the Kaaba seven times.
  • Sa'i: Running between the hills of Safa and Marwa seven times.
  • Wuquf: Standing on the plain of Arafat and praying for forgiveness.
  • Rammy al-Jamarat: Throwing stones at three pillars that represent the devil.
  • Eid al-Adha: Sacrificing an animal and distributing the meat to the poor.
